Section 281A — Resource Management Act 1991: Registrar may waive, reduce, or postpone payment of fee

Text of the provision Official document

281A Registrar may waive, reduce, or postpone payment of fee (1) The Registrar may waive, reduce, or postpone the payment to the Court of any fee prescribed by regulations made under this Act. (2) The powers in subsection (1) may be exercised only if— (a) the person responsible for paying the fee is unable to pay the fee in whole or in part; or (b) in the case of proceedings concerning a matter of public interest, the proceedings are unlikely to be commenced or continued if the powers are not exercised. Sections 281A and 281B were inserted, as from 10 August 2005, by section 104 Resource Management Amendment Act 2005 (2005 No 87). See sections 131 to 135 of that Act as to the transitional provisions.
